Video: 2013 Latin American Cities Conferences: Rio de Janeiro

In partnership with Rio Negocios, AS/COA held a conference in Rio de Janeiro focused on entrepreneurship and innovation, recreating Silicon Valley in Latin America, and technology in Rio de Janeiro.

Rio de Janeiro is attracting billions of dollars in investments leading up to the 2014 World Cup and 2016 Olympics, as well as a result of recent offshore oil discoveries. But infrastructure and oil are not the only sectors booming in the state. Entrepreneurs are choosing Rio de Janeiro as a base to found startups, and a flourishing technology scene is emerging as large foreign companies build world-class research centers.
